Positioned for success

For those seeking a high quality, traditional British education in a renowned Preparatory School, without the lifestyle sacrifices associated with being city based, S. Anselm’s offers the perfect choice.

The school is situated in one of the most scenic and desirable areas of Britain, at the heart of the Peak District National Park and nestled on the hillside above the Parish Church in the ancient market town of Bakewell.

Location

For families wishing to re-locate, the area offers some of the most beautiful real estate in the country with considerably more square feet/per £sterling than areas within or adjacent to the UK’s city conurbations, and with some of the the best rural amenities in the UK.  Surrounding villages boast Michelin starred restaurants and hotels, historic country houses abound (think well known film locations such as Chatsworth, Haddon, Eyam, Tissington made famous by ‘Pride and Prejudice’ and ‘Jane Eyre’), and the sporting opportunities offered by the natural Peak District landscape attract tourists from around the world.

Yet Bakewell is within easy commuting distance of the UK’s third city, Manchester as well as nearby Sheffield and Chesterfield.  Fast commuter trains also run morning and evening from Chesterfield to London (journey time: 1hr 50 mins).

For families seeking full boarding for their child(ren), S. Anselm’s offers a school-life choice like no other, enhanced by the scenic beauty and opportunities within our local area, of which our boarding activities take full advantage.  Our boarding houses offer a home from home and our boarding team understands the particular challenges that overseas pupils face when moving away from home and how to make it a positive and happy experience.  We pride ourselves in providing a complete package of care and support for our overseas and long distance families.  Exeat and holiday care can be provided either at school by our resident teams or via use of a guardian service.

An ideal blend of traditional and modern

S. Anselm’s combines a winning formula of traditional values twinned with modern and progressive approaches to learning, informed by latest research and practice.

Our traditional values centre on a family-oriented approach.  Meals are taken in the Dining Hall, and served from the head of each table by teachers, who encourage lively conversation and engagement.  Customs and special occasions are celebrated with real effort and enthusiasm, from Christmas Feasts to House events.  Nothing is more evident than the good manners and courtesy for which S. Anselm’s children are recognised, underpinned by their kindness and consideration for others.

Yet we prepare our children to be outward thinking global citizens, exploratory in their approaches to problem solving and creative in spirit.  Learning takes place as much in first hand contexts as in the classroom, and educational visits – to the theatre, historic and geographical sites and more – abound.

Small class sizes (never exceeding 14, with smaller sets) provide dedicated tutoring, focus and pastoral care whilst facilitating exploration and creativity.  Our children are instilled with purpose, inspired and motivated to apply themselves in their work and discover real enjoyment in learning.

From Prep to Senior School: the best educational options

Since 1888, S. Anselm’s Preparatory School has prepared children for entry to their Senior School of choice including many of the UK’s top educational institutions.  Our commitment is focused firmly on each child and each family and, as such our Preparatory School remains proudly independent, offering tailored advice and support to ensure their next destination is right for them.

Whilst some families know from an early age that they wish their son or daughter to attend a particular public school, many do not make a decision until much later on.

S. Anselm’s provides a nurturing environment that challenges children to explore the full breadth of their capabilities and to achieve their full potential.  Along this journey, particular talents, strengths and interests often emerge that suggest a particular destination might be suited to a child’s future ambitions and aspirations. Our independent position enables us to respond to this.

The strength of S. Anselm’s long standing relationships with major Senior/Public Schools gives us a strong working knowledge of each school and its environment so we can offer guidance and insight to our families.  We work closely with the Registrars/Directors of Admissions at these schools, who hold S. Anselm’s children in exceptionally high regard.  Each year. S. Anselm’s pupils are welcomed by schools such as Eton, Harrow, Uppingham, Oundle, Repton and Shrewsbury and Winchester, to name but a few.  Further details of our pupils’ onward destinations are available here.
